Hotei #317-A. Prior to our June 2003 article, was an UN-documented Hasui print. (Incorrectly listed by
Hotei as a "variant" of the common #317 Watanabe "summertime Kasuga" print.) |
Comments |
Extremely rare. Perhaps the only Hasui image by Shimbi Shoin Publisher. In original "calendar state"
as issued by Japanese Government Railways in 1935/36.
